Transaction 8affdeebee91dfb3c4bca72eac476bf6b2f2ef3aa89b18b9dbc43e039e3f1fec

66 Input
1 Outputs
  • 8affdeebee91dfb3c4bca72eac476bf6b2f2ef3aa89b18b9dbc43e039e3f1fec:0
  • value  64557786
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h